摘要
光子大科学装置主要分为同步辐射光源和自由电子激光装置两大类,可以产生光子能量范围从红外到硬X射线的高通量、高亮度、光子能量连续可调的光,在过去半个多世纪里已经发展成为服务于物理学、化学、材料科学、生命科学、能源、环境科学等众多学科的综合性科研中心.光子大科学装置在我国经过了40多年的发展,已经建立起较完整的体系,达到世界先进水平.文章通过对已有的和建设中的装置的描述分别介绍同步辐射光源和自由电子激光在国内的发展历程和现状,并对未来发展趋势进行展望.
Abstract
Large-scale user facilities for photon science,including synchrotron radiation sources and free-electron lasers,produce high flux,high brightness light with photon energy ranging from infrared to hard X-ray and continuously tunable.As a result,synchrotron radiation sources and free-electron lasers become the centers of scientific research for multiple fields such as physics,chemistry,material science,life sciences,energy,and environmental sciences over the past half a century.In China,synchrotron radiation sources and free-electron lasers have been developed for four decades and state-of-the-art facilities are under construction,making China one of the major powers of these facilities.In this paper,the history and present state of synchrotron radiation sources and free-electron lasers in China are described through introducing the existing and upcoming facilities,with brief discussions on future development.
